A tissue membrane is a thin layer or sheet of cells that covers the outside of the body (for example, skin), the organs (for example, pericardium), internal passageways that lead to the exterior of the body (for example, abdominal mesenteries), and the lining of the moveable joint cavities.There are two basic types of tissue … WebEmbryos of complex organisms, like humans, form three germ layers. In human embryos, the endoderm and ectoderm interact to form a third germ layer between them. That layer is called the mesoderm. WebJul 11, 2024 · Why do walleye have big eyes? Walleyes are named for their large, glassy, opaque eyes. This odd appearance is due to a layer of light-gathering tissue at the back of the eye called the tapetum lucidum This light-sensitive tissue enables walleyes to be largely nocturnal.
